S
- Sandbox Environments
- Secure Coding Practices
- Security Automation
- Security Awareness Training
- Security Champions
- Security Information and Event Management (SIEM)
- Security Orchestration
- Security Posture
- Shift-Left Security
- Smart City
- Smart Home
- Smart Manufacturing
- Smart Meters
- Smart Products
- Smart Spaces
- Software as a Service (SaaS)
- Software Composition Analysis (SCA)
- Software Defined Networking (SDN)
- Software Development Life Cycle (SDLC)
- Static Application Security Testing (SAST)
- Structured Data
Application Infrastructure
Simple Definition for Beginners:
Application infrastructure is the set of hardware, software, and network resources required to run and support applications effectively.
Common Use Example:
A company sets up a cloud-based application infrastructure to host its web services, ensuring scalability and reliability for its users.
Technical Definition for Professionals:
Application infrastructure refers to the comprehensive framework of hardware, software, networking, storage, and services that collectively provide the foundation for deploying, managing, and supporting applications. This includes servers, databases, middleware, network equipment, and cloud services. The primary goal of application infrastructure is to ensure that applications run efficiently, securely, and reliably. Key components involve load balancing, data centers, virtualization, containerization (e.g., Docker, Kubernetes), and monitoring tools. Application infrastructure must be designed to support scalability, high availability, disaster recovery, and performance optimization. It is crucial for both on-premises and cloud environments, enabling seamless integration, deployment, and operation of enterprise applications.
Application Infrastructure